انتقل إلى المحتوى الرئيسي

ما المقصود بنهج بدون حاجة إلى ETL؟

ما المقصود بنهج بدون حاجة إلى ETL؟

عدم الحاجة إلى ETL هو مجموعة من التكاملات التي تقلل من الحاجة إلى بناء مسارات بيانات ETL. الاستخراج والتحويل والتحميل (ETL) هي عملية دمج، وتنظيف، وتسوية البيانات من مصادر مختلفة لتجهيزها لأعباء عمل التحليلات، والذكاء الاصطناعي (AI)، وتعلم الآلة (ML). عمليات ETL التقليدية تستغرق وقتًا طويلًا ومعقدة من حيث التطوير والصيانة والتوسيع. بدلًا من ذلك، تُسهل تكاملات عدم الحاجة إلى ETL نقل البيانات من نقطة إلى نقطة دون الحاجة إلى إنشاء مسارات بيانات ETL. يمكن أن تتيح عدم الحاجة إلى ETL أيضًا إجراء الاستعلامات عبر صوامع البيانات دون الحاجة إلى نقل البيانات. 

اقرأ عن ETL »

ما تحديات ETL التي يحلها تكامل zero-ETL؟

تعمل عمليات تكامل zero-ETL على حل العديد من تحديات حركة البيانات الحالية في عمليات ETL التقليدية.

زيادة تعقيد النظام

تضيف مسارات بيانات ETL طبقة إضافية من التعقيد لجهود تكامل البيانات الخاصة بك. يتضمن تعيين البيانات لتتناسب مع المخطط المستهدف المطلوب قواعد معقدة لرسم خرائط البيانات، ويتطلب معالجة عدم تناسق البيانات والتعارضات. يجب عليك تنفيذ آليات فعالة لمعالجة الأخطاء والتسجيل والإخطار لتشخيص المشكلات. تزيد متطلبات أمان البيانات من القيود المفروضة على النظام.

التكاليف الإضافية

تُعد مسارات ETL باهظة الثمن في البداية، ولكن يمكن أن تتصاعد التكاليف مع نمو حجم البيانات. قد لا يكون تخزين البيانات المكررة بين الأنظمة ميسور التكلفة بالنسبة لأحجام البيانات الكبيرة. بالإضافة إلى ذلك، غالبا ما يتطلب توسيع نطاق عمليات ETL ترقيات مكلفة للبنية التحتية، وتحسين أداء الاستعلام، وتقنيات المعالجة المتوازية. إذا تغيرت المتطلبات، يتعين على فريق هندسة البيانات مراقبة واختبار مسار سير العمل باستمرار في أثناء عملية التحديث، مما يزيد من تكاليف الصيانة.

تأخر الوقت المخصص للتحليلات والذكاء الاصطناعي وتعلم الآلة

تتطلب عملية ETL عادةً من مهندسي البيانات إنشاء تعليمات برمجية مخصصة، بالإضافة إلى مهندسي عمليات التطوير (DevOps) لنشر وإدارة البنية التحتية المطلوبة لتوسيع نطاق عبء العمل. في حالة حدوث تغييرات في مصادر البيانات، يتعين على مهندسي البيانات تعديل التعليمات البرمجية الخاصة بهم يدويًا ونشرها مرة أخرى. يمكن أن تستغرق العملية أسابيع، مما يتسبب في حدوث تأخيرات في تشغيل التحليلات، والذكاء الاصطناعي، وأعباء عمل تعلم الآلة. علاوة على ذلك، فإن الوقت اللازم لإنشاء مسارات بيانات ETL ونشرها يجعل البيانات غير مناسبة لحالات الاستخدام في الوقت الفعلي تقريبًا مثل وضع الإعلانات عبر الإنترنت أو اكتشاف المعاملات الاحتيالية أو تحليل سلسلة التوريد في الوقت الفعلي. في هذه السيناريوهات، يتم فقدان فرصة تحسين تجارب العملاء أو معالجة فرص عمل جديدة أو تقليل مخاطر الأعمال.

ما فوائد zero-ETL؟

تقدم Zero-ETL العديد من الفوائد لاستراتيجية بيانات المؤسسة.

زيادة المرونة

يعمل Zero-ETL على تبسيط بنية البيانات وتقليل جهود هندسة البيانات. كما يسمح بإدراج مصادر بيانات جديدة دون الحاجة إلى إعادة معالجة كميات كبيرة من البيانات. تعمل هذه المرونة على تعزيز السرعة ودعم صنع القرار المستند إلى البيانات والابتكار السريع.

كفاءة التكلفة

تستخدم Zero-ETL تقنيات تكامل البيانات المبنية بالسحابة والقابلة للتطوير، مما يسمح للشركات بتحسين التكاليف بناءً على الاستخدام الفعلي واحتياجات معالجة البيانات. تعمل المؤسسات على تقليل تكاليف البنية التحتية وجهود التطوير ونفقات الصيانة العامة.

تقليل وقت الحصول على الرؤى

غالبًا ما تتضمن عمليات ETL التقليدية تحديثات تصحيح دورية، مما يؤدي إلى تأخر توافر البيانات. أما Zero-ETL، فتوفر الوصول إلى البيانات في الوقت الفعلي أو شبه الفعلي، مما يضمن بيانات أحدث للتحليلات والذكاء الاصطناعي/تعلم الآلة وإعداد التقارير. يمكنك الحصول على رؤى أكثر دقة وفي الوقت المناسب لحالات الاستخدام مثل لوحات المعلومات في الوقت الفعلي وتجربة ألعاب محسَّنة ومراقبة جودة البيانات وتحليل سلوك العملاء. تقوم المؤسسات بعمل تنبؤات تعتمد على البيانات بمزيد من الثقة، وتحسِّن تجارب العملاء، وتعزز الرؤى القائمة على البيانات عبر الأعمال.

ما حالات الاستخدام المختلفة لـ zero-ETL؟

هناك ثلاث حالات استخدام رئيسية لـ zero-ETL.

استيعاب سريع للبيانات

تحتاج المؤسسات إلى استيعاب وتحليل أنواع مختلفة من البيانات بسرعة لاتخاذ القرارات في الوقت الفعلي. يوفر Zero-ETL نهجًا مرنًا لاستيعاب البيانات بسرعة وبشكل مباشر في مستودعات البيانات ومستودعات بحيرات البيانات. ويزيل هذا النهج الحاجة إلى مسارات الاستخراج والتحويل والتحميل (ETL) التقليدية، مما يسمح للمؤسسات بالتكيف مع متطلبات العمل المتغيرة بسهولة.

استيعاب تدفق البيانات

تبث منصات تدفق البيانات وقوائم انتظار الرسائل بيانات في الوقت الفعلي من مصادر متعددة. يتيح لك تكامل zero-ETL مع مستودع البيانات استيعاب البيانات من تدفقات متعددة من هذا القبيل وتقديمها للتحليلات على الفور تقريبًا. ليست هناك حاجة إلى تنظيم البيانات المتدفقة، حيث تقدم هذه المنصات أيضًا تحويلات وتحليلات غنية في أثناء انتقال البيانات.

النسخ المتماثل الفوري

تقليديًا، كان نقل البيانات من قاعدة البيانات التشغيلية والمعاملاتية إلى مستودع بيانات مركزي ومستودع بحيرة بيانات يتطلب دائمًا حلًا معقدًا لعمليات ETL. وفي الوقت الحاضر، يمكن أن يعمل zero-ETL كأداة للنسخ المتماثل للبيانات، حيث يقوم بنسخ البيانات فوريًا من قاعدة البيانات التشغيلية، وقاعدة البيانات المعاملاتية، والتطبيقات إلى مستودع البيانات ومستودع بحيرة البيانات. تستخدم آلية النسخ المتماثل تقنيات التقاط بيانات التغيير (CDC) وقد تكون مدمجة في مستودع البيانات ومستودع بحيرة البيانات. يكون النسخ المتماثل غير مرئي للمستخدمين؛ حيث تقوم التطبيقات بتخزين البيانات في قاعدة البيانات المعاملاتية، بينما يستعلم المحللون عن البيانات من المستودع بسلاسة.

كيف يمكن لـ AWS دعم جهودك في عدم الحاجة إلى ETL؟

تستثمر AWS في مستقبل خالٍ من عمليات استخراج وتحويل وتحميل البيانات (ETL) إليك أمثلة على الخدمات التي تقدم دعمًا مدمجًا لعدم الحاجة إلى ETL.

يدعم الآن إصدار Amazon Aurora MySQL وAmazon RDS for MySQL تكامل عدم الحاجة إلى ETL مع Amazon SageMaker، مما يتيح توفر البيانات في الوقت الفعلي تقريبًا لأعباء عمل التحليلات.

دعم مخزن بيانات Amazon SageMaker وAmazon Redshift لتكاملات عدم الحاجة إلى ETL من التطبيقات، والذي يعمل على أتمتة استخراج البيانات وتحميلها من التطبيقات إلى مخزن بيانات Amazon SageMaker وAmazon Redshift.

يعمل تكامل عدم الحاجة إلى ETL بين Amazon DynamoDB ومخزن بيانات Amazon SageMaker على أتمتة استخراج وتحميل البيانات من Amazon DynamoDB إلى Amazon SageMaker Lakehouse، وهي بحيرة بيانات معاملات مبنية على Amazon S3.

يتيح تكامل عدم الحاجة إلى ETL بين خدمة Amazon OpenSearch وAmazon CloudWatch Logs الاستعلام المباشر عن بيانات السجلات وتصورها في الوقت الفعلي تقريبًا، مما يجعل إدارة السجلات مركزية بدون مسارات معقدة أو معالجة مسبقة.

يتيح تكامل عدم الحاجة إلى ETL بين خدمة Amazon OpenSearch وAmazon Security Lake البحث المباشر في البيانات الأمنية وتحليلها، مما يقضي على تحديات تكامل البيانات مع تقليل التعقيد والأعباء التشغيلية والتكاليف من خلال تسريع البيانات عند الطلب والإمكانات التحليلية الغنية.

يتيح تكامل عدم الحاجة إلى ETL بين Amazon Aurora وAmazon Redshift إجراء التحليلات وتعلم الآلة في الوقت الفعلي تقريبًا. تستخدم Amazon Redshift لأعباء عمل التحليلات على بيانات المعاملات من Aurora والتي يصل حجمها إلى عدد من البيتابايت. إنه حل مُدار بالكامل لإتاحة بيانات المعاملات في Amazon Redshift بعد حفظها في كتلة Aurora DB.

يساعد تكامل عدم الحاجة إلى ETL بين Amazon RDS لـ MySQL وAmazon Redshift على استخلاص رؤى شاملة عبر العديد من التطبيقات وكسر صوامع البيانات في مؤسستك، مما يسهل تحليل البيانات من مثيل واحد أو عدة مثيلات Amazon RDS لـ MySQL في Amazon Redshift.

يوفر تكامل عدم الحاجة إلى ETL بين Amazon DynamoDB وخدمة Amazon OpenSearch للعملاء إمكانات بحث متقدمة، مثل البحث في النص الكامل والبحث المتجه، على بيانات Amazon DynamoDB الخاصة بهم.

يوفر تكامل عدم الحاجة إلى ETL بين Amazon DocumentDB وخدمة Amazon OpenSearch للعملاء إمكانات بحث متقدمة، مثل البحث الضبابي والبحث عبر المجموعات والبحث المتعدد اللغات، على مستندات Amazon DocumentDB الخاصة بهم باستخدام واجهة برمجة تطبيقات OpenSearch.

يمثل تكامل عدم الحاجة إلى ETL بين خدمة Amazon OpenSearch وAmazon S3 طريقة جديدة وفعالة للعملاء للاستعلام عن سجلات التشغيل في بحيرات بيانات Amazon S3، مما يلغي الحاجة إلى التبديل بين الأدوات لتحليل البيانات.

يتيح تكامل عدم الحاجة إلى ETL بين Amazon Aurora PostgreSQL وAmazon Redshift إجراء التحليلات وتعلم الآلة في الوقت الفعلي تقريبًا باستخدام Amazon Redshift لتحليل بيتابايت من بيانات المعاملات من Aurora.

يتيح تكامل عدم الحاجة إلى ETL بين Amazon DynamoDB وAmazon Redshift للعملاء تشغيل تحليلات عالية الأداء على بيانات DynamoDB الخاصة بهم في Amazon Redshift دون أي تأثير على أعباء عمل الإنتاج التي تعمل على DynamoDB. 

ابدأ واستفد من عدم الحاجة إلى ETL على AWS من خلال إنشاء حساب مجاني اليوم!

Browse all cloud computing concepts

Browse all cloud computing concepts content here:

جار التحميل
جار التحميل
جار التحميل
جار التحميل
جار التحميل

Did you find what you were looking for today?

Let us know so we can improve the quality of the content on our pages